No. Plain cashews are a good source of monounsaturated fats. Cashews are almost entirely fat by calories though, so it's important to remember that just a handful or so can have hundreds of calories. A little bit goes a long way. This advice applies to plain cashews only. Salting, oiling, adding sugar or candy coatings all greatly reduce the nutritional density of cashews.
